前言
在企业为客户远程部署、技术教学、远程技术支持等场景中,稳定、低延迟的远程工具是完成 AI 工具部署的关键。本地部署无需依赖云服务器,成本更低、更安全,但传统远程软件往往延迟高、操作卡顿,严重影响部署效率。
本文将以 OpenClaw 轻量 AI 辅助服务工具为部署对象,依托远程协作工具实现流畅远程控制与协助,详细讲解从环境准备、OpenClaw 远程部署,到基于远程工具的实时监视 OpenClaw 状态的全流程。
一、远程协作工具介绍
远程协作工具是一款轻量化、零配置、高稳定的远程控制工具,区别于传统远程工具(如 SSH、Xshell),它无需公网 IP、无需端口映射、无需配置防火墙,完美适配 Windows 本地部署场景,是本次 OpenClaw 部署和监控的核心辅助工具。
其核心优势:
- 零配置上手:安装后注册登录即可使用,无需复杂网络设置,适配 Windows 系统;
- 本地终端辅助:支持 Windows 本地终端,支持同步粘贴板,打开 CMD/PowerShell 对代码进行 copy 时减少操作失误;
- 多端互通:适配手机和平板,让在闲暇之余也可以直接打开随时观察;
- 安全且防窥:拥有被控端防窥模式,能够让被控端黑屏保护,安全性提升。
二、OpenClaw 介绍
OpenClaw 是一款 MIT 开源、本地优先的 AI 自动化代理(Agent),主打代码辅助、自然语言交互、任务自动化等核心功能,无需复杂的服务器配置,可直接在 Windows 本地运行,适配个人办公、轻量开发等场景。
其核心特性:
- 环境依赖简单:仅需 Node.js(v18+)即可完成安装,无需额外部署数据库、依赖包,Windows 系统可直接适配;
- 本地 Web UI 访问:部署成功后,通过浏览器即可访问 OpenClaw 的 Web 界面,操作直观、易用;
- 命令行灵活控制:支持通过命令行启动、重启、停止服务,查看运行日志,便于配合远程工具实现远程管理;
- 配置简单可自定义:可修改端口、跨域设置等,适配本地部署的各类场景。
三、远程协作准备工作
本文将会使用远程协作工具的两大功能(远程协作、远程控制)来实现对 openclaw 的远程部署和远程监视。
- 远程协助:控制端对被控制端发起远程请求后,控制端在远程状态下对被控制端进行一系列操作;
- 远程控制:远程工具的同一账号登录在不同设备下,一个设备端通过远程软件对自己的另一个设备进行远程操作。
在开始 OpenClaw 部署前,需先完成远程协作工具的准备工作,确保其能正常辅助部署、联动飞书。
(一)准备条件
- 本地电脑:Windows 10/11 64 位系统,确保正常联网;
- 网络环境:无需公网 IP、无需配置防火墙,普通家庭/办公网络即可,确保双方环境网络保持稳定;
- 账号准备:双方都注册远程协作工具账号,用于登录客户端及绑定飞书;
- 飞书准备:安装飞书客户端(手机/电脑均可),登录账号(后续用于下发命令);
- 双方准备:将被控制端的设备码 ID 发给控制端,准备启用远程协作功能。
(二)具体准备步骤
- 下载并安装远程协作工具 Windows 客户端:打开官网下载对应 Windows 版本安装包,双击运行,勾选'静默启动''开机自启'(可选),点击下一步,无需额外配置,即可完成安装;
- 登录远程协作工具客户端:安装完成后,打开客户端,使用注册的账号密码登录,登录后客户端会自动识别本地电脑,在'我的设备'中显示本机信息,完成初始化;
- 控制端和被控制端进行远控连接,控制端设备输入被控制端的设备 ID 码发远程协作请求。
四、OpenClaw 远程协作部署具体步骤
本章节为核心操作,全程通过远程协作工具辅助执行,步骤清晰、命令可直接复制。
(一)部署前置准备
OpenClaw 依赖 Node.js(v18+)和 Git,借助远程协作工具需被部署端,打开电脑 CMD 完成安装。
- 发起远程协作:对被部署端发起协作请求,输入对方的设备 ID 和验证码后可以直接远程操作对方电脑;
- 控制电脑打开 PowerShell:操作电脑打开 PowerShell 窗口,随后依次输入以下命令,安装 Git 和 Node.js(v18+):
# 安装 Git(Windows 命令,远程终端执行)
winget install --id Git.Git -e --source winget
# 安装 Node.js(v18.17.0 版本,适配 OpenClaw)
winget install --id OpenJS.NodeJS -e --source winget -v 18.17.0
# 验证安装是否成功
git --version
node --version
npm --version
(二)正式部署步骤
- 安装 OpenClaw:在远程终端中,执行以下命令,全局安装 OpenClaw 核心程序,自动下载并安装,无需手动操作:
iwr -useb https://openclaw.ai/install.ps1 | iex
安装完成后,会出现'openclaw'的字样时,说明成功安装。
- 初始化配置:安装完之后进行初始化设置,接下来跟着选项选择即可。
步骤 1:欢迎界面
首先是欢迎界面和安全警告,选择 Yes 回车。
◆ I understand this is powerful and inherently risky. Continue? │ ● Yes / ○ No
选择 Yes 回车。
步骤 2:模式选择
Onboarding mode │ ● QuickStart (Configure details later via openclaw configure.) │ ○ Manual
选择 QuickStart 回车。
步骤 3:模型选择
◆ Model/auth provider
这里可以选择千问 Qwen 模型,因为是国内自研的大模型,所以在国内使用非常方便,只需要注册一个账号即可,就可以直接免费使用。
选择之后,会跳出认证界面,这时候我们就可以弄自己的账号即可,弄完之后就可以使用模型了。
步骤 4:配置消息渠道
◆ Select channel (QuickStart)
同样,如果没有你希望的渠道,选择 Skip for now 跳过,稍后接入飞书插件后再进行配置。
步骤 5:配置 Skills 和 hooks
◇ ◆ Configure skills now? (recommended) │ ● Yes / ○ No
随便选择一个就行,后面一般会根据自己的需求安装。
◇ Configure skills now? (recommended)
比如选一个 apple-notes,回车,等待安装。
◇ Preferred node managerforskill installs │ bun │ ◇ Install missing skill dependencies │ apple-notes │ ◇ Installed apple-notes
这里 hooks 也选择跳过,这里跳过是先空格,再回车才会进行跳过。
步骤 6:配置各种 Key
然后会提示你配置各种各样的服务 Key,全部选 No 回车跳过就行。
步骤 7:安装服务
接下来会自动安装服务。
步骤 8:配置文件位置
最后会问题如何访问,选择哪个都行。
不熟悉命令行的选择 Open theWeb UI。
系统就会打开 Web UI,你可以在浏览器中访问。跳过也没关系,下面会将如何访问。
至此,安装算是完成了。
这时候我们发现会自动跳出浏览器网页,这就是我们的 openclaw 的 web ui 界面,也就是聊天界面。
如果发现自己的聊天没有回答,说明自己没有选好大模型 LLM,回到步骤三重新配置一下!!!
(三)将 openclaw 接入飞书
1. 配置飞书开放平台 sdk
让我们来到 git 界面输入安装 sdk 的代码:
npm install @sdkpack/feishu
进入到飞书目录:
cd enable_openclaw_feishu_lark
检测 npm:
npm install
接入 App_ID:
export FEISHU_APP_ID="你的 ID"
接入 APP_SECRET:
export FEISHU_APP_SECRET="你的 SECRET"
运行插件:
npm run ws
2. 飞书开放平台控制台
- 创建企业自建应用
- 寻找应用凭证:将应用凭证的 App_ID 和 App_Secret 记录下来,之后装 sdk 要用到
- 添加应用能力机器人进行配置
- 对权限管理进行配置,将信息与群组的权限全部打开
- 事件与回调的订阅方式选择长连接,这里就是我们刚才为什么要配置 SDK,没有配置的话,就无法选择长连接
- '添加事件'的按钮按需添加,可以下面只添加个接受信息即可
- 发布
这时,我们就已经完全接入了飞书,同时也完成了 openclaw 的远程部署。
这时远程协作工具协作功能就可以结束了,也代表着我们给用户已经部署好了。
接下来我们可以让用户用他们自己的设备监视部署好的 openclaw。
五、远程工具远程控制准备工作
(一)具体准备步骤
- 不同设备登录同一账号:将需要远程监视的设备登录上与部署好 openclaw 的设备登录上同一账号,远程工具会自动检测设备;
- 连接远程控制设备:进入设备界面之后点击'进入界面'直接实现远程控制;
- 远程控制显示:被控制端出现此界面说明连接成功,之后移动端可以控制自己的设备了。
六、基于远程工具的实时监视 OpenClaw 状态
部署完成后,日常需监控 OpenClaw 的运行状态、执行重启、停止等操作,我们可通过飞书下发命令,借助远程工具并查看执行结果,实现远程监控、便捷运维,无需登录本地电脑。
大多数人的苦恼的一点是:在移动端给机器人下达命令,但由于设备限制,无法很好的查看实时监视 openClaw 的状态,但远程工具远程控制可以很好的解决这个痛点,即我们不仅可以采用移动端设备下达命令,同时也可以基于远程工具的远程控制用移动端实时查看反馈情况。
这是 openclaw-gateway 终端日志界面:
日志内容显示了:
- 钩子(Hook)的注册与加载情况
- 飞书(Feishu)机器人的启动与 WebSocket 连接状态
- WebSocket 客户端(如 OpenClaw 控制 UI)的连接与交互记录
- 各种命令(如
node.list、device.pair.list、chat.history)的执行响应
(一)用移动端给飞书下用远程工具实时查看
移动端下达命令:
命令二:帮我记录任务
移动端实时监视:
- 同时我们可以用移动端的远程工具进行实时查看
openclaw-gateway终端日志界面,可以借助远程工具突破设备限制,对反馈状态了如执掌,同时终端日志界面只显示飞书。 - 在借助远程工具开展远程监控的过程中,我们能清晰发现,其设备画面与指令执行画面的同步表现十分出色,同步精度达到了极高水准,使工作效率大幅度提升。
总结
以远程工具为核心,完整走通了从 OpenClaw Windows 本地部署到飞书远程命令监控的全流程。
依托远程工具的低延迟与高同步特性,我们无需云服务器、无需复杂网络配置,就能实现'本地部署 OpenClaw → 飞书远程发令 → 远程工具实时监控'的闭环操作。无论是企业为用户远程交付,还是技术教学,用户都能直接复制步骤,轻松完成 AI 辅助服务的部署与管理。
在体验过程中,远程工具的流畅操作和稳定连接,让远程部署与监控变得高效便捷。若遇到问题,只需通过远程工具终端查看 OpenClaw 日志,或重新执行相关命令,即可快速排查解决,大幅提升了远程协作与工作效率。


